Analysis

What the Futures Lab is

Google and the University of Waterloo ran an eight-week intensive AI and user experience prototyping workshop called Futures Lab. The article says students from fields including computer science, business and natural sciences worked on tools meant to reshape how people learn.

The prototypes

Three projects are highlighted. Kanji Garden teaches Japanese through immersive, AI-generated stories and visuals rather than rote memorization. SignFluent is a real-time American Sign Language learning tool that gives instant feedback on form. MuscleMemory is an on-the-go calisthenics training tool that uses AI camera tracking to give audio feedback on exercise form, with the goal of helping prevent injuries.

What the partnership is trying to do

The article says the partnership, led by Dr. Edith Law, the Google Chair in the Future of Work and Learning, goes beyond theory so students can co-create technology that may shape the future of education and work. The framing is practical: these are prototypes, not finished products, but they are already being tested as working ideas.

What students learned

The article also surfaces lessons from the teams. The MuscleMemory team found that non-technical skills such as applied communication can matter in prototyping. The Kanji Garden team learned to approach challenges with a user-centered mindset. The SignFluent team learned product design at the intersection of accessibility and technology.
